What is the meaning of Supply?
To provide (something), to make (something) available for use.
To fill up, or keep full.
To compensate for, or make up a deficiency of.
To serve instead of; to take the place of.
To act as a substitute.
To fill temporarily; to serve as substitute for another in, as a vacant place or office; to occupy; to have possession of.
The act of supplying.
An amount of something supplied.
The market force that causes sellers to be both willing and able to sell a good or service, as measured by the amount of that good or service that is currently available to be bought at any given price point; the amount itself.
An amount of money provided, as by Parliament or Congress, to meet the annual national expenditures.
Somebody, such as a teacher or clergyman, who temporarily fills the place of another; a substitute.
Supplely: in a supple manner, with suppleness.
